Tim Bryant qualified in 1979 and worked in London's West End as a commercial surveyor, before setting up a general practice surveying firm, which developed into a chain of five offices throughout the Home Counties.
During the 1990s, he focused on project management and, amongst other projects, delivered the first off-airport bonded cargo warehouse at Heathrow for KLM. This involved the negotiation of the purchase of the land from Esso, overseeing the construction of a 25,000sq m building, the fit-out and the investment sale.
At the same time, he was managing the development of several mixed office/retail/residential buildings in Clerkenwell, on the edge of the City of London, and he entered into a number of joint venture companies with his clients.
Another notable project during this period was the purchase of the former Oxfam offices in Summertown, Oxford, following Oxfam's relocation to the Oxford Business Park. As a principal of Summertown Properties, he oversaw the acquisition, refurbishment and extension of the properties, culminating in the letting and sale of the properties.
Now, as a director of Abingworth Developments, Tim continues to pursue both residential and commercial projects in the West and East Sussex areas.
